Average All Occupations Salary in Idaho Falls, ID

In Idaho Falls, ID, the average annual salary for All Occupations stands at $58,340. This figure is notably below the national average of $67,140, suggesting that local economic factors and industry demand play a significant role in compensation levels within the region. The specific economic landscape and industry mix of Idaho Falls contribute to this differential.

All Occupations Salary Distribution in Idaho Falls, ID

Salary progression in All Occupations typically sees a significant increase with experience. Entry-level positions might start closer to the lower percentiles, while senior or highly specialized roles can command salaries in the upper percentiles. The widening gap between entry-level and senior roles signifies substantial career growth opportunities and the value placed on accumulated expertise.

Experience LevelMarket PercentileAnnual WageHourly Rate
Entry LevelStarting career. Focus on acquiring core skills.10% (Entry)$27,270$13.1
ExperiencedProficient professional working independently.25% (Junior)$43,755$21
Mid-LevelEstablished expert. Standard market value.50% (Median)$45,080$21.7
Senior LevelAdvanced skills, leadership or specialist role.75% (Senior)$72,925$35.1
Top TierIndustry leader / Executive level compensation.90% (Expert)$103,200$49.6
